Join OHAAT at Humpty’s Dumplings in Glenside and satisfy your tastebuds while supporting the Beds for Kids program! 15% of sales will be donated to OHAAT (this does not include orders for delivery/DoorDash/GrubHub).
OHAAT's Beds for Kids program provides children and youth living in poverty in the Philadelphia area with beds, bedding, and tools that encourage healthy bedtime habits so they can get the quality and sufficient sleep they need to thrive.

Ministry Spotlight on Stewardship
Hello Gloria Dei! My name is Sarah, and I am the leader of the Stewardship Committee. In this role, I support the church with my time, talents and giving.
Why do I support the church? I wanted to feel connected to something other than my immediate family after a life-change. Connection to my community by giving back and participating was the goal. Church was my answer, and I started attending Gloria Dei in 2019.
The Statement of Faith was welcoming, and the church community provided me with a sense of spiritual direction and connections. These are the reasons why I give my time and talents and continue to invest in the church. Supporting the connections with the church and the community that I have gained through Gloria Dei has been rewarding for me and my family.
My thanks to all church members who, through your stewardship of time, abilities and money, enable our church to be a church of good news to spread!
